SUSE Announces Cloud Native Nanodegree Program, Sponsors 300 Scholarships

SUSE has joined hands with Udacity to launch the Cloud Native Application Architecture Nanodegree program to address an industry-wide talent shortage in the critical area of cloud native application delivery.

In addition, SUSE is sponsoring 300 scholarships to aspiring cloud native practitioners for the full Nanodegree curriculum. The scholarship awards will be merit based and allocated across a diverse range of course participants.

Sarah Whitlock, vice president, SUSE & Rancher Community, at SUSE, said: “This premier program will empower application developers and operations specialists with leading-edge cloud native application delivery skills and expertise.”

Scholarship applications for the Cloud Native Application Architecture Nanodegree program are now being accepted through May 25. Select applicants will be eligible to take the first course in the program, Cloud Native Foundations.

The free, online course introduces basic skills needed to develop and deploy cloud native applications. Following completion of the course, 300 top performers will be selected to receive a scholarship for the full Cloud Native Application Architecture Nanodegree program which will be available later this year.
